In Memory of Shirley Timberlake
Shirley Joyce Timberlake, daughter of the late William Edward Robinson and Dessie Ray Pulliam Robinson was born in Dudley, Missouri on February 28, 1935 and departed this life in Hunter Acres Caring Center of Sikeston, Missouri on Monday, September 4, 2017 at the age of 82.

Ms. Timberlake was a homemaker, was a beloved Aunt and had Mothered the Whole Palmer Family and was a resident of Bernie.
 
Survivors include her five Nephews, Jack W. Palmer & wife Mary of Bernie, Missouri, Ronald G. Palmer of Bernie, Missouri, Larry D. Palmer & wife Joyce of Bloomfield, Missouri, Johnny R. & wife Sheri of Bernie, Missouri and Mark “Randy” Palmer & wife Vivian of Wesley Chapel, Florida; by five Nieces, Sandra K. Cryts of Bernie, Missouri, Linda F. Merritt of Bernie, Missouri, Rita A Burch & husband Glen of Bernie, Missouri, Brenda E. Smith & husband Larry of Bloomfield, Missouri and Sally J. Cloninger of Bernie, Missouri; also by other relatives and friends.

She was preceded in death other than by her parents, by one sister, Dorothy Beatrice Robinson Palmer; by three brothers, Albert Edward Robinson, Kenneth Donald Robinson and Rev. Wilford Eugene Robinson; by three nieces, Deborah Palmer, Linda Jane Ford and Kathleen A. Smetana; by one nephew, Thomas William Robinson.
 
Friends may call at Rainey-Mathis Funeral Home in Bernie, Missouri on Saturday, September 9, 2017 from 10:00 A.M. until 11:00 A.M.  

A memorial service will then be conducted in the Rainey-Mathis Funeral Chapel starting at 11:00 A.M.

Interment will follow in Bernie Cemetery. Rainey-Mathis Funeral Home in charge of Arrangements.
